Report Date: February 16, 2015
Current Conditions
The fly fishing on the Eagle has been excellent as the unseasonably warm weather continues. We have even seen fish rising on most days as midge hatches intensify. The hatches now consist mainly of midges but BWO nymphs are becoming increasingly effective. Small nymphs and emergers trailing an egg pattern fished deep have been the ticket for big fish. Late morning through late afternoon is when fish are feeding.

Pressure on the Eagle is light and winter is the time for wade fishermen to target bigger fish that were unreachable during higher water flows of summer. Try the Eagle in the town of Avon or Wolcott. The Eagle may become muddy below Milk Creek west of Wolcott.
